We understand that every organization uses different terms to describe leadership levels. Below are the terms we use and what we mean by them.

Senior Leaders

Top-level executives within an organization, such as Executive Directors, CEOs, COOs, or Presidents; those responsible for setting the strategic vision, making critical decisions, and guiding the overall direction of the organization.

People Managers

Individuals who manage and lead teams or departments within an organization, responsible for employee development, performance management, and fostering a positive work environment.

Board of Directors

A group of individuals chosen to provide oversight, governance, and strategic guidance to the organization, ensuring it operates in the best interest of community stakeholders as a public trust.

Full Staff

All employees in an organization, regardless of role, collectively responsible for accomplishing tasks and contributing to the achievement of the organization's goals.
